Hotpoint RLAV21P
Summary
Very bad quality. Could not be repaired. As we used it in an office, there was no warranty and they felt that there was no moral grounds for doing anything about it. Everyone I have spoken to agrees that this should not happen to a three month old fridge.
The only plus side is that the retailer - Redhill Appliances - have agreed to dispose of the old one and redeliver a new (different model) fridge, free of charge.
Which similar products have you used?
Other undercounter fridges
How long have you used the product?
1-3 months
- What are the strengths?
- It looks like a good quality fridge - it had very good storage space to keep the office milk in and a few sandwiches.
- What are the weaknesses?
- The fridge stopped keeping things cool after three months. The engineer came out and reported an internal gas leak and wet wall blown so it was not repairable.

hotpoint RLAV21P
Summary
A few minor annoyances but overall a good fridge.
How long have you used the product?
Less than 1 month
- What are the strengths?
- Temperature control on outside . Adjustable shelves. Full width, easy to handle, salad bin. Plenty big enough for 2 of us.
- What are the weaknesses?
- the internal light is not deep inside the fridge making it difficult to see things at very back . The covered shelf, at top of the door is not easy to open.
